Webb12 maj 2024 · The People Could Fly is a 1985 compilation of twenty-four folktales about African-American slaves, by Virginia Hamilton and illustrated by Leo and Diane Dillon. It includes fictional texts, such as animal tales, fantastic fairy stories, and tales of the supernatural, as well as nonfictional chronicles of slavery and attempts to reach freedom. WebbSay that long ago in Africa, ome of the people knew magic. And they would walk up on the air like climbin’ up on a gate. And they flew like blackbirds over the fields. Black, shiny wings flappin’ against the blue up there. Then, many of the people were captured for Slavery. The ‘ones that could fly shed their wings.
